Message type: E = Error
Message class: RSPC - Process Chains
Message number: 152
Message text: Chain &1 runs infrequently or rarely. Prognosis not possible

- Chain &1 runs infrequently or rarely. Prognosis not possible ?The SAP error message RSPC152 indicates that a specific process chain (denoted as &1) runs infrequently or rarely, making it difficult for the system to provide a prognosis or prediction regarding its performance or behavior. This message typically arises in the context of SAP BW (Business Warehouse) or SAP BW/4HANA when dealing with process chains that are responsible for data loading, transformation, and reporting.
Cause:
- Infrequent Execution: The process chain may be scheduled to run at long intervals or only under specific conditions, leading to insufficient historical data for the system to analyze its performance.
- Lack of Historical Data: If the process chain has not been executed enough times, the system lacks the necessary data to make a prognosis about its future runs.
- Configuration Issues: There may be issues with the configuration of the process chain, such as incorrect scheduling or dependencies that prevent it from running more frequently.
- Data Volume: If the data volume is low, the process chain may not be triggered often, leading to the same prognosis issue.
Solution:
- Increase Execution Frequency: If possible, adjust the scheduling of the process chain to run more frequently. This will help gather more data for prognosis.
- Review Dependencies: Check the dependencies of the process chain to ensure that it is not being held up by other processes or chains that are not running as expected.
- Monitor Execution: Regularly monitor the execution of the process chain to identify any issues or bottlenecks that may be affecting its frequency.
- Analyze Logs: Review the logs of the process chain to identify any errors or warnings that may indicate why it is not running as often as expected.
- Test Runs: Perform manual test runs of the process chain to gather data and see if it behaves as expected.
